determinar rango a Contar con contar.si

03/09/2005 - 22:21 por Oscar | Informe spam
Hola Grupo: : )

Tengo el siguiente problemao cuestion. Si alguien le puede hechar un ojo,
gracias...

Quiero determinar en una tabla sencilla, cuantos tengo por arriba de un
cierto numero, ejemplo:

Arriba de 90 lo hago con contar.si(E1:E5,">90") Sin problema
Abajo de 80 lo hago con contar.si(E1:E5,"<80") Sin problema

Pero como determino cuales estan es ese inter (entre 80 y 90) ???
Ya lo intente pero ya me bloquee

Gracias por leer estas lineas

Saludos

Preguntas similare

Leer las respuestas

#6 Toni
04/09/2005 - 20:35 | Informe spam
Hola, KL,

Creo que todo es cuestión de semántica. Es decir, Si Oscar al decir:

"Pero como determino cuales estan es ese inter (entre 80 y 90) ???"

Está incluyendo 80 y 90? O tal vez los quiera obviar.

Normalmente cuando decimos los números enteros que hay entre 1 y 10,
mencionamos
del 2 al 9. Entre Pinto y Valdemoro no se incluyen dichas poblaciones.

De todas maneras, centrándonos en las fórmulas, tu fórmula original
=CONTAR.SI(E1:E5,">80")-CONTAR.SI(E1:E5,">90")


Incluye el 90 pero. excluye el 80 !!!!

Creo que, a mi modesto entender, las fórmulas serían:

Para incluír 80 y 90:

1. =CONTAR.SI(E1:E5,">€")-CONTAR.SI(E1:E5,">90")
2. =SUMAPRODUCTO((E1:E5>€)*(E1:E5<))

Para excluír 80 y 90:

1. =CONTAR.SI(E1:E5,">80")-CONTAR.SI(E1:E5,">")
2. =SUMAPRODUCTO((E1:E5>80)*(E1:E5<90))



Saludos,
A.Andrés

"KL" escribió en el mensaje
news:
Hola Toni,

Solo una pregunta: ?que te hace pensar que el 90 debe estar excluido? En
el mensaje original de OP ambas formulas excluyen el 90:

Arriba de 90 lo hago con contar.si(E1:E5,">90") Sin problema
Abajo de 80 lo hago con contar.si(E1:E5,"<80") Sin problema



Si Oscar usa tu formula, el 90 estara "perido en el espacio" ;-)

Saludos,
KL



"Toni" wrote in message
news:%
Creo que funciona con una pequeña variación:

=CONTAR.SI(E1:E5,">80")-CONTAR.SI(E1:E5,">")


A.Andrés


"KL" escribió en el mensaje
news:%
Hola Oscar,

Que tal esto:

=CONTAR.SI(E1:E5,">80")-CONTAR.SI(E1:E5,">90")

Saludos,
KL


"Oscar" wrote in message
news:
Hola Grupo: : )

Tengo el siguiente problemao cuestion. Si alguien le puede hechar un
ojo,
gracias...

Quiero determinar en una tabla sencilla, cuantos tengo por arriba de un
cierto numero, ejemplo:

Arriba de 90 lo hago con contar.si(E1:E5,">90") Sin problema
Abajo de 80 lo hago con contar.si(E1:E5,"<80") Sin problema

Pero como determino cuales estan es ese inter (entre 80 y 90) ???
Ya lo intente pero ya me bloquee

Gracias por leer estas lineas

Saludos













Respuesta Responder a este mensaje
#7 KL
04/09/2005 - 21:24 | Informe spam
Hola Toni,

Creo que todo es cuestión de semántica. Es decir, Si Oscar al decir:
"Pero como determino cuales estan es ese inter (entre 80 y 90) ???"
Está incluyendo 80 y 90? O tal vez los quiera obviar.
Normalmente cuando decimos los números enteros que hay entre 1 y 10,
mencionamos
del 2 al 9. Entre Pinto y Valdemoro no se incluyen dichas poblaciones.



En primer lugar, ?que pinta aqui la semantica si ya tenemos las formulas que
carecen por completo de tal cosa? Y hablando de semantica, la expresion
"Entre Pinto y Valdemoro" si que significa no estar ni en Pinto ni en
Valdemoro sino entremedio, pero en el dia a dia usamos la palabra entre
tanto como incluyente como excluyente. De ahi que casi siempre necesitamos
concretizarlo. De todas formas, habiendo dos posibles interpretaciones de la
palabra 'entre', las formulas expuestas por Oscar deberian ser determinantes
sin ningun lugar a duda.

De todas maneras, centrándonos en las fórmulas, tu fórmula original
> =CONTAR.SI(E1:E5,">80")-CONTAR.SI(E1:E5,">90")
Incluye el 90 pero. excluye el 80 !!!!



Aqui te doy la razon.

1. =CONTAR.SI(E1:E5,">80")-CONTAR.SI(E1:E5,">")
2. =SUMAPRODUCTO((E1:E5>80)*(E1:E5<90))



De acuerdo con esta parte, aunque la segunda version con SUMAPRODUCTO es
veces mas lenta que la primera, cosa que se notaria en modelos con formulas
abundantes y rangos extensos.

Saludos,
KL
Respuesta Responder a este mensaje
#8 Héctor Miguel
04/09/2005 - 23:12 | Informe spam
hola, chicos !
[y yo que creia que era 'el unico'... 'fijado'... en cuestiones como: 'semantica'... y similares]
[aparte de 'pregunton' de cuestiones como: 'lo que se esta quedando en el tintero'...] :DD

Toni dice...
... cuestion de semantica... Si Oscar al decir: "Pero como determino cuales estan es ese inter (entre 80 y 90) ???"
Esta incluyendo 80 y 90? O tal vez los quiera obviar [...]



KL dice...
... que pinta aqui la semantica si ya tenemos las formulas que carecen por completo de tal cosa?
... en el dia a dia usamos la palabra entre tanto... incluyente como excluyente
... habiendo dos posibles interpretaciones de la palabra 'entre'
... las formulas expuestas por Oscar deberian ser determinantes sin ningun lugar a duda.



Oscar dice...
expresion 1: > 'Arriba de 90 lo hago con contar.si(E1:E5,">90") Sin problema'
-> 'semantica1': 'arriba de 90' significa 'superior a...' 90 ->por lo tanto<- ... 90 se incluye

expresion 2: > 'Abajo de 80 lo hago con contar.si(E1:E5,"<80") Sin problema'
-> 'semantica2': 'abajo de 80' significa 'inferior a...' 80 -> por lo tanto<- ... 80 se incluye

expresion 3: > 'Pero como determino cuales estan es ese inter (entre 80 y 90) ???'
-> 'semantica3': alguna duda ??? :DD
si alguna duda... favor de preguntarselo a OP :))

saludos,
hector.
Respuesta Responder a este mensaje
#9 Toni
05/09/2005 - 01:19 | Informe spam
Hola Héctor Miguel,

Sin querer entrar en polémica y (aunque sólo sea para asentar los
términos en futuras consultas) a modo de modesta opinión:

Cuando se indica "arriba de 90" significa superior a 90 por lo que
90 no se incluye. Algo superior a 90 menos 90 debe ser superior
a cero. 90 menos 90 igual a cero.

Creo que, para que se incluya 90, la expresión debería ser
 "mayor o igual a 90".



Lo mismo con el 80 pero "menor o inferior".

Creo que la clave del asunto quizás no esté tanto en temas
semánticos (de diferente apreciación según país y/o localización
del parlante), sino en el detalle de matizar ">" o ">="

Espero que Oscar que, involuntariamente, originó el debate no se
haya visto agobiado o abrumado con tantas fórmulas y
comentarios a su pregunta inicial.

Saludos a todos
A.Andrés.


expresión 1: > 'Arriba de 90 lo hago con contar.si(E1:E5,">90") Sin
problema'
-> 'semántica: 'arriba de 90' significa 'superior a...' 90 ->por lo
tanto<- ... 90 se incluye
Respuesta Responder a este mensaje
#10 Héctor Miguel
05/09/2005 - 01:47 | Informe spam
hola, Toni !

Sin... polemica y (aunque solo sea para asentar los terminos en futuras consultas) a modo de modesta opinion:



-> creo que 'asi' es todo lo que se aporta en estos foros :)) [lo que 'veo dificil' es que puedan 'asentarse terminos a futuro'] :D

Cuando se indica "arriba de 90" significa superior a 90 por lo que 90 no se incluye.
Algo superior a 90 menos 90 debe ser superior a cero. 90 menos 90 igual a cero.
Creo que, para que se incluya 90, la expresión deberia ser >> "mayor o igual a 90".
Lo mismo con el 80 pero "menor o inferior".
Creo que la clave del asunto quizas no este tanto en temas semanticos... sino en el detalle de matizar ">" o ">="



tienes toda la razon en cuanto a la importancia de 'detallar el matiz' de la 'deseada comparacion'... ">" o... ">="
aunque creo que sigue 'interviniendo' [un mucho/poco] la 'semantica' ->de la oracion/intencion/exposicion/...<-
[o simplemente... tratando de 'armar' lo que se quedo en el tintero -que sucede una que otra ocasion-] :)) [p.e.]

de las 'expresiones originales' [Oscar] 1 2 y 3... si las 'escuchas en secuencia'...
Arriba de 90 lo hago con contar.si(E1:E5,">90") Sin problema
Abajo de 80 lo hago con contar.si(E1:E5,"<80") Sin problema
Pero como determino cuales estan es ese inter (entre 80 y 90) ???



de la primera expresion [se 'deduce' que] 'superiores a 90'... ->se excluyen<- por lo cual, el 90... ->se incluye<- [en 'la cuenta']
de la segunda expresion [se 'deduce' que] 'inferiores a 80'... ->se excluyen<- por lo cual, el 80... ->se incluye<- [en 'la cuenta']
[creo] de la 'confusa claridad'... que se desprende de las expresiones anteriores... se 'clarifica la confusion' de la tercera expresion :D

SI [por una parte] 80 y 90... se incluyen ->en la cuenta<-
[por la otra parte] 80 y 90... se excluyen... ->en el inter<- ???

saludos,
hector.
email Siga el debate Respuesta Responder a este mensaje
Ads by Google
Help Hacer una pregunta AnteriorRespuesta Tengo una respuesta
Search Busqueda sugerida